Thanks. This is not by blade, the view shows only information from the logs. You need to activate accounting in the relevant rules and the logs will show this information and view as well. You can add this to the log in the track section in the policy.

@Amir_Senn How can we import this ?
I have imported some .cpr file going into Reports > Import Template but .7z is not being allowed to import. Any other way around this ?

Hi,
I couldn't attach the CPR file here, so I used 7zip and uploaded it.
You can extract the CPR file from the 7z and import it as usual.
